摘要
Indonesian SMEs need to increase their competitive advantage because they are dealing with high business discontinuation rate. Sustainable competitive advantage in SMEs can be fostered by conscious and systematic approach of knowledge management, called knowledge management cycle. This paper aims to identify the phases and develop the indicators of knowledge management cycle in SMEs based on literature review. The phases and indicators identified are 6 knowledge identification indicators, 9 knowledge creation and acquisition indicators, 5 knowledge storage and retrieval indicators, 6 knowledge dissemination indicators, and 4 knowledge application indicators. These indicators are useful for assessing knowledge management practices in Indonesian SMEs. For further research, a model can be developed to examine the relationship between knowledge management cycle and performance in Indonesian SMEs.
